What Makes Skyline Luge Sentosa Special?

Singapore: Skyline Luge Sentosa Entry Ticket - What Makes Skyline Luge Sentosa Special?

Nestled on the lush island of Sentosa, Skyline Luge combines adventure with breathtaking sights. The attraction’s standout feature is its gravity-powered luge rides—think of it as a go-kart on a track, but with a little more thrill and a lot more scenery. The four tracks—Dragon, Jungle, Kupu Kupu, and Expedition—cater to different tastes, from tight turns to scenic meanders, ensuring everyone from kids to thrill-seekers finds something to enjoy.

The Ride: Luge Tracks

The Luge carts are easy to steer, even for first-timers. The tracks are designed with safety in mind, but also packed with enough twists and tunnels to add an element of adventure. The Dragon Trail is the longest at 688 meters, featuring exciting hairpin corners, while the Jungle Trail takes you on a slightly shorter, lush ride through green surroundings. The Kupu Kupu Trail is perfect for those who want scenic vistas, and the Expedition Trail adds surprises with more twists.

The Skyride: The View from Above

The Skyride takes you to the top of the tracks in a scenic chairlift, giving you uninterrupted views of Sentosa’s beaches, the skyline, and the South China Sea. The breathtaking vistas are often highlighted by visitors, with some noting that “amazing views from the lift” make the entire trip worthwhile. It’s also a great way to orient yourself on the island while building anticipation for the luge ride.

Practical Details: What to Expect

Singapore: Skyline Luge Sentosa Entry Ticket - Practical Details: What to Expect

The entire activity, from ticket exchange at the counters to completing a ride, typically takes 15 to 20 minutes. During busy periods or school holidays, expect longer queues, but the staff seem well-trained to keep lines moving efficiently.

The activity is designed to be family-friendly; kids over 6 can ride alone on the luge, provided they meet the 110cm height requirement. For younger children, there’s the option to ride with an adult at a reduced price of SGD12 for unlimited rides—ideal for families wanting to maximize fun.

The safety briefings are thorough, and staff are both friendly and knowledgeable—some reviews mention “helpful, professional staff”. The helmets are well-maintained, though some visitors noted that larger helmets can be scarce during busy times.

The activity is wheelchair accessible, with staff assistance available, ensuring inclusivity for guests with mobility issues. However, pregnant women and those with certain medical conditions are advised not to participate.

Value for Money and Ticket Options

At SGD27 (~$20 USD), the entry fee is reasonable for what you get: a scenic ride up on the Skyride, multiple luge runs, and the thrill of racing or just relaxing to the view. You can also select multi-ride packages or branded merchandise if you want a souvenir.

Booking in advance and choosing a “reserve and pay later” option can offer flexibility, especially if your plans are subject to change. The full experience—with multiple rides and the scenic lift—can be a worthwhile investment for a memorable day on Sentosa.

FAQ

Singapore: Skyline Luge Sentosa Entry Ticket - FAQ

Is the Skyline Luge suitable for children?
Yes, kids over 6 years old can ride independently if they meet the height requirement of 110cm. Younger children can ride with an adult using the Child Doubling ticket.

How long does a single ride take?
Expect about 15 to 20 minutes for a full ride experience, including the Skyride to the top and the luge down the track.

Can I do more than one ride?
Absolutely. Multiple ride options are available, and many visitors, like Leanne, choose to do several in one day.

Are there options for night rides?
Yes, the Night Luge offers illuminated tracks for a magical experience after sunset.

Is it wheelchair accessible?
Yes, staff assistance is available, and the chairlifts can be slowed or stopped if needed.

What’s included in the ticket?
Your ticket covers the ride on the Skyride, the Luge, and, depending on your selection, branded merchandise.

How busy does it get?
During school holidays or peak hours, queues can be longer, but staff work efficiently to keep wait times reasonable.

Can I change my booking date?
Yes, the provider allows booking flexibility with “reserve and pay later” options, and staff are helpful with schedule adjustments.

Is the activity safe?
Yes, safety is a priority with comprehensive briefings, well-maintained helmets, and staff presence at all times.

What should I wear?
Comfortable clothing suitable for outdoor activity, and if you plan to swim afterward, bring a bathing suit.
